linux命令显示用户id

worktile 其他 24

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ux命令可以使用id来显示用户的用户id。
    id命令用于显示当前登录用户的用户id、组id以及所属的组。

    使用方法:
    “`
    id
    “`
    执行上述命令后,会立即显示当前用户的用户id、组id以及所属的组。

    示例输出:
    “`
    uid=1000(username) gid=1000(username) groups=1000(username),4(adm),24(cdrom),27(sudo),30(dip),46(plugdev),113(lpadmin),128(sambashare)
    “`
    在上述输出中,uid表示用户id,gid表示组id,groups表示所属的组。示例中的用户id为1000,组id也为1000,用户所属的组为username,并且还属于其他一些组。

    除了默认显示当前登录用户的id信息外,id命令还可以指定其他用户名作为参数,以显示特定用户的id信息。

    例如,显示用户名为”guest”的用户id信息:
    “`
    id guest
    “`

    如果当前用户具有足够的权限,还可以使用id命令显示其他用户的id信息。

    总结:
    使用id命令可以直接显示用户的用户id、组id以及所属的组,非常方便快捷。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用多种命令来显示用户的ID。以下是五个常用的命令:

    1. id命令:id命令用于显示当前用户的ID。在终端中输入id,即可显示用户的UID(User ID),GID(Group ID),以及所属的组的ID。

    2. whoami命令:whoami命令用于显示当前用户的用户名。在终端中输入whoami,即可显示当前用户的用户名。

    3. finger命令:finger命令用于显示指定用户的详细信息,包括用户名、实名、终端、登录时间、用户ID等。在终端中输入finger [username],即可显示指定用户的信息。

    4. getent命令:getent命令用于获取指定数据库的记录,可以用来获取用户和组的信息。例如,可以使用getent passwd命令来获取所有用户的信息,包括用户ID。该命令会列出系统中的所有用户及其相关信息。

    5. cat /etc/passwd命令:该命令可以显示所有用户的信息。在终端中输入cat /etc/passwd,即可显示系统中所有用户的信息,包括用户名、用户ID等。

    这些命令可以帮助用户快速查看和获取用户的ID信息,方便进行系统权限管理和用户身份识别。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ux操作系统中,可以使用”id”命令来显示用户的ID。该命令可以显示当前登录用户的用户ID(UID)、组ID(GID)以及所属的附加组ID。

    下面是详细的操作流程:

    1. 打开终端:在Linux系统中,使用终端来执行命令。可以使用快捷键”Ctrl + Alt + T”来打开终端,或者在”应用程序”菜单中找到终端应用。

    2. 输入命令:在终端中输入”id”命令的具体格式为:id [OPTION]… [USERNAME]

    其中,[OPTION]为命令选项,可以根据需要选择;[USERNAME]为要查询的用户名,默认为当前登录用户。

    例如,要显示当前登录用户的ID信息,直接输入”id”命令即可。

    要显示某个特定用户的ID信息,可以在命令中指定用户名,例如:id username

    3. 执行命令:按下”Enter”键执行命令。

    4. 查看结果:命令执行后,终端会显示出用户的ID信息。

    例如,以下是”id”命令执行后显示的示例输出:

    uid=1000(username) gid=1000(username) groups=1000(username),4(adm),24(cdrom),27(sudo),30(dip),46(plugdev),116(lpadmin),126(sambashare)

    解释:
    – uid=1000:用户的UID(用户ID),这里是1000。
    – gid=1000:用户所属的GID(组ID),这里是1000。
    – groups=1000(username),4(adm),24(cdrom),27(sudo),30(dip),46(plugdev),116(lpadmin),126(sambashare):用户所属的附加组ID列表,以逗号分隔显示。

    注意:实际输出中的数值和用户名可能会有所不同,具体取决于系统中的配置和用户设置。

    通过以上步骤,你可以使用”id”命令来显示Linux系统中的用户ID信息。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部